Biography

Sebastián Loiácono is graduated from Manuel de Falla National Higher Conservatory of Music, in addition to taking private lessons with prominent saxophonists: George Garzone, Eric Alexander, Gary Smulyan, Antonio Hart, Vincent Herring.

In his trips to New York he has played with Ron McClure (USA), Leo Genovese (ARG), Joe Cohn (USA), Earl Grice (USA), Johnny O'Neal, etc.

In 2017 he was part of the Vincent Herring (USA) sextet on his tour of Argentina together with Anthony Wonsey (USA), David Williams (USA), Willie Jones III (USA) and Mariano Loiácono (ARG). During the same year he played with Luis Perdomo (VEN), Mimi Jones (USA) and Rudy Royston (USA) trio. In addition, he was selected to be part of the Louis Sclavis (FRA) residence in the Usina del Arte of Buenos Aires.

In 2018 he participated in the tour of Argentina by the David Williams (USA) Quartet with Eric Alexander (USA), David Hazeltine (USA) and Joe Farnsworth (USA). In June of the same year he performed with Sheila Jordan in Buenos Aires and Rosario. Likewise, on the day of "International Jazz Day" he played with Antonio Hart and the Big Orchestra of CCK.

In addition, with Dave Douglas (USA) during his time in Buenos Aires and later with Gary Smulyan (USA) in the framework of the Buenos Aires jazz festival.

In 2019 he performed concerts with Carl Allen (USA), Clarence Penn (USA) and Cyrus Chesnut (USA) in their respective visits to Argentina. In November he recorded his first album as a leader with Harold Danko (USA), Jay Anderson (USA) and Jeff Hirshfield (USA) which has just been released .

In 2022 he toured Spain playing at the Milano Jazz Club in Barcelona and the Jimmy Glass in Valencia. Additionally, he played with Eve Cornelious (USA) and Antonio Hart (USA) on their respective tours of Argentina. 

So far in 2023 shared on the Argentine stage with Steve Davis (USA); He was part of the Carl Allen Quintet (USA) with Donald Vega (Nicaragua), Liany Mateo (USA) and Mariano Loiacono (ARG) and was also a member of the Quintet of the great singer Mary Stallings (USA). 

He is currently part of Mariano Loiácono Quintet, Mariano Loiácono Big Orchestra, Julia Moscardini Group and leads his own quintet. In addition to working as a teacher in Carlos Giraudo Higher Music Conservatory, Marcos Juarez city, Córdoba.
